‘Walking Dead’ Creator Robert Kirkman to Appear at Con for L.A. Wildfires Recovery

Robert Kirkman constructed a comic book dominion through The Walking Dead, his exploration of human resilience in the face of misfortune and devastation. He will now lend a hand in rebuilding after the Los Angeles wildfires, appearing at MultiCon – a convention that contributes to the recovery efforts.

Kirkman is the most recent notable figure to share his thoughts at the convention that took place on February 22 at The Preserve LA. Other guests who were announced on Friday include Sean Gunn, known for his role in ‘Guardians of the Galaxy’, Bitsie Tulloch from ‘Superman & Lois’, Michael Cudlitz, who has been seen in both ‘Superman & Lois’ and ‘The Walking Dead’, Khary Payton, a star of ‘The Walking Dead’, Scott M. Gimple, the showrunner for ‘The Walking Dead’, and Shar Jackson, best known for her role in ‘Moesha’.

They’ve become part of an existing lineup that includes Kevin Smith, David Dastmalchian, Seth Green, and Rob Liefeld. The event proceeds are donated to United Way of Greater Los Angeles, with ticket prices starting at $35. For a VIP experience, tickets costing $100 are available for purchase here.

Fans can donate additional money for autograph signings and selfies with talent.

Beyond the panel presentations, MultiCon will offer various other entertainment options. These include a nighttime performance by Don’t Tell Comedy as part of MultiCon After Dark, along with music performances from Sofar Sounds. Fork n’ Film, an immersive culinary movie experience, is also set to be a part of the event. Furthermore, Golden Apple Comics will conduct an auction featuring items such as a piece signed by both Stan Lee and Liefeld.

In a forthcoming development, Off-Brand Games is set to launch its fighting title sequel, dubbed “Rivals of Aether II“. Meanwhile, Fantasy Flight Games and the Star Wars: Unlimited franchise are planning an exciting in-game activation.
